Konica Minolta collaborates with Tamura TECO

January 21, 2021

Konica Minolta, Inc. announced that the company has concluded a comprehensive collaboration agreement with Tamura TECO Co., Ltd. (Tamura TECO), an Osaka-based leading maker of ozone-related products that are effective for removing viruses, to help prevent the spread of COVID-19 and create a clean and safe living environment.

The scope of collaboration includes contract manufacturing of ozone gas products, whose production system needs to be expanded rapidly to meet the growing demand from medical institutions and fire departments across Japan due to the Covid-19 pandemic, and procurement of parts to increase the manufacturing capacity. Konica Minolta has been selling some of Tamura TECO’s existing products through the Group’s sales channels.

Key points of the agreement include:

  • Procurement of parts and OEM manufacturing by taking full advantage of Konica Minolta’s manufacturing skills and capability
  • Commencement of sales of some of Tamura TECO’s products through the Konica Minolta Group’s sales channels
  • Joint development of new products for medical use and product control systems
  • Utilization of an integrated platform with peripheral devices

Previously, a high-concentration ozone gas was shown to effectively inactivate E. Coli, influenza viruses, norovirus, pollen, and COVID-19. In August 2020, it was verified that low-concentration ozone gas is effective for decontaminating COVID-19 based on experiments conducted by Fujita Health University. The results showed that ozone generators (capable of generating ozone at a low concentration and maintaining an appropriate concentration) can be used constantly at a concentration permissible for the human body at places where people gather, such as medical facilities, public transport systems, and offices, to prevent the spread of COVID-19.

Tamura TECO uses the expertise acquired through these demonstration experiments to develop products. The company optimally controls the CT value (ozone concentration multiplied by exposure time), which is an important index for ensuring the effectiveness and safety of ozone gas, to commercialise products. As COVID-19 has spread, Tamura TECO has received a huge increase in orders from medical institutions and fire departments across Japan, and so needs to quickly expand its production system.

Against this backdrop, Konica Minolta will help expand Tamura TECO’s production system by using its production and procurement capability. The collaboration will study the possibility of jointly developing, manufacturing, and selling new products for medical use and using Konica Minolta’s integrated platform in the future.
